Output de5db391069ff465a0a9745a196153ee5121e30dfb29f6785b0a8ab36a74669a:25

value
3548649
script pubkey
OP_0 OP_PUSHBYTES_20 ba2c34314cc6b8fa25ebf968322556dbb4d24b49
address
bc1qhgkrgv2vc6u05f0tl95ryf2kmw6dyj6fqh4n9x
transaction
de5db391069ff465a0a9745a196153ee5121e30dfb29f6785b0a8ab36a74669a